Destination Niagara USA Press Release & Photo
Destination Niagara USA is proud to announce its continued support of the Niagara Falls Fire Department annual Toy Fund. For the past three years, DNUSA has raised funds through the sale of holiday ornaments, with 100% of profits benefitting the Toy Fund.
In 2025, DNUSA expanded the initiative by launching a “Christmas in July” promotion, boosting fundraising efforts well beyond the traditional holiday season.
The campaign helped generate record-breaking results, with a total of $1,278.72 raised through ornament sales – the highest amount since DNUSA began supporting the Toy Fund.
“This partnership embodies the spirit of Niagara Falls USA – coming together to make a difference in our community,” said John Percy, president and CEO of Destination Niagara USA. “We are proud to support the Niagara Falls Fire Department Toy Fund in their mission to spread holiday cheer and ensure children in our community have a brighter holiday season.”
Founded in 1928, the Niagara Falls Fire Department Toy Fund has been a cherished tradition in the community, providing toys, clothing and other necessities to children and families in need during the holiday season.
“We are grateful for the support of Destination Niagara USA and the generosity of those who purchased ornaments this year,” said Vincent Orsi, president of the Niagara Falls Fire Department Toy Fund. “These funds help us continue our work in making the holidays brighter for children and families across Niagara Falls, ensuring that no child is left without a gift or warm clothing this season.”
